...

aaPanel magyarázat: Az ingyenes webtárhely vezérlőpanel Ázsiából

aaPanel ingyenesen egy modern, könnyen használható vezérlőközpontot kínál a Linux szerverek számára bármely root vagy VPS host számára. Elmagyarázom, hogyan használom az aaPanelt a webhelyek, adatbázisok, biztonsági és WordPress-csomagok gyors beállítására, és miért fut az eszköz évek óta szerverek millióin.

Központi pontok

Röviden összefoglalom a legfontosabb szempontokat, mielőtt részletesebben kitérnék a részletekre. Ezáltal gyors áttekintést kap, és rögtön eldöntheti, hogy szeretné-e tesztelni az aaPanelt. Megmutatom az alapvető funkciókat, amelyekkel minden nap időt takarítok meg. Azt is elmagyarázom, hogy hol csillog az aaPanel, és hol van értelme a fizetős kiegészítőknek. Végül pedig konkrét tippeket adok, amelyek segítenek a projektek megfelelő beállításában.

  • Ingyenes magán- és üzleti célokra
  • Egy kattintás LAMP/LEMP és alkalmazások
  • WP eszközkészlet WordPress csapatok számára
  • Biztonság WAF és Fail2ban segítségével
  • Migráció Plesk/cPanelből lehetséges

Mi az aaPanel? Kompaktan elmagyarázva

Az aaPanelt használom Web hosting panel Linuxra, mert a szerver és a weboldalak gyors kezelésére használom. A felület a gyakori shell parancsokat kattintható modulokként képezi le, így mindenféle kitérő nélkül hozhatok létre weboldalakat, adatbázisokat, SSL-t, cron-feladatokat és levelezőszolgáltatásokat. A projekt 2017 óta folyamatosan növekszik, és mostanra már több mint 3 millió létesítmények világszerte. A platform gyakori frissítéseket, új modulokat és többnyelvű felhasználói felületet biztosít, amely németül is tisztán néz ki. Számomra ez egy ideális beállítás a projektek egyértelmű kezeléséhez a tesztrendszertől a termelési környezetig.

Gyors indítás: telepítés percek alatt

Az aaPanelt frissre állítottam Ubuntu- vagy CentOS szervereket egy egysoros programmal, majd jelentkezzen be közvetlenül a böngészőben. Először biztosítom az SSH hozzáférést, és ellenőrzöm, hogy a tűzfalszabályok engedélyezik-e a panel portjait. Ezután bemásolom a telepítési parancsot a dokumentációból a terminálba, és elindítom a rutint. Néhány perc múlva készen van az indítófelület, és megadom az alapvető szolgáltatásokat, mint például a webszerver, a PHP-verziók, az adatbázis és a levelezőszolgáltatás. Ha szeretné összehasonlítani, hasznos tippeket találhat az alábbiakban aaPanel vs HestiaCP; Ez az összehasonlítás segít a megfelelő verem kiválasztásában.

A WordPress hatékony futtatása a WP Toolkit segítségével

A WordPress esetében nagyban támaszkodom az integrált WP eszközkészlet. Egyetlen kattintással telepítem a példányokat, központilag kezelem a bővítményeket és témákat, és a kiválasztott webszerver-motornak megfelelő gyorsítótárazási profilokat aktiválom. A frissítéseket, biztonsági mentéseket és visszaállításokat közvetlenül a panelből indítom el, és megkímélem magam a különálló szkriptektől. Különösen praktikus: klónozom a staging környezeteket, és tesztelem a változtatásokat, mielőtt élesbe kapcsolnám őket. Ez lehetővé teszi számomra, hogy a projekteket gyorsan, biztonságosan és könnyen karbantarthatóan tartsam fenn - anélkül, hogy minden aprósághoz külön bash-szkripteket kellene fenntartanom.

Mindennapi funkciók: adminisztráció, biztonság, biztonsági mentések

A mindennapi üzletmenetben nagyra értékelem a Fájlkezelő és az integrált kódszerkesztővel, amikor gyorsan ellenőriznem kell a konfigurációs fájlokat. A felhasználó- és jogosultságkezelés megkönnyíti a kollégáknak való átadást anélkül, hogy SSH-hozzáférést kellene osztogatnom. Adatbázisok tekintetében a MySQL/MariaDB, PostgreSQL és MongoDB áll rendelkezésre, beleértve a biztonsági mentéseket és az automatizálást is. Távoli tárolást, például S3-kompatibilis vödröket használok az offsite biztonsági mentésekhez, hogy a visszaállítási idők rövidek legyenek. A naplók, a felügyelet és a riasztások biztosítják, hogy a hibákat idejekorán felismerjem, és a szolgáltatásokat célzottan finomhangoljam.

aaPanel vs. Plesk, cPanel & Co.

Az ár-teljesítmény arány egyértelműen a következők mellett szól aaPanel, különösen akkor, ha sok webhelyet vagy konténerhalmazt tartok a saját fém vagy VPS-emben. A kereskedelmi alternatívák pontokat szereznek a vállalati bővítményekkel, de a legtöbb projektet az aaPanel plusz a kiválasztott bővítményekkel fedezem le. Az üzleti szempontból fontos alkalmazásokhoz még mindig megbízható támogatásra és nagy teljesítményű szerverekre van szükségem, ezért tartom szemmel a menedzselt ajánlatokat. Olyan összehasonlításokat találok, mint Enhance és aaPanel, az erősségek csoportosítása a csapat mérete és a munkafolyamatok szerint. Az alábbi táblázat rövid áttekintést ad a gyakori lehetőségekről és azok irányultságáról.

Helyszín Vezérlőpult Ár Fókuszpontok
1 webhoster.de Díjköteles Nagy teljesítmény, német IP-k, prémium támogatás
2 aaPanel Ingyenes Széles körű funkciók, egyszerű működés, aktív közösség
3 Plesk Díjköteles Skálázás, piactér, Docker támogatás
4 cPanel Díjköteles Széles körű terjesztés, részletes dokumentáció
5 DirectAdmin Díjköteles Megbízható licenckezelés, egyszerű működési logika

Biztonság és frissítések

Aktiválom az integrált Tűzfal, Futtatom a biztonsági ellenőrzést, és értelmes szabályokkal állítom be a Fail2ban-t. A WAF kiszűri a tipikus támadásokat, míg az érzékeny területeken IP-korlátozást és kétfaktoros bejelentkezést használok. Napi inkrementális biztonsági mentéseket ütemezek heti teljes biztonsági mentésekkel, adatbázis és webroot szerint elkülönítve. A frissítéseket azonnal telepítem, és a hibák elkerülése érdekében előbb tesztelem őket a staging példányokon. Ez a rutin tisztán tartja a rendszereket, és incidensek esetén észrevehetően csökkenti a válaszidőt.

Fejlesztők és ügynökségek számára

Az aaPanelt kombinálom a Docker, Redis és node stackek, ha a projektek mikroszolgáltatásokat vagy valós idejű funkciókat igényelnek. A Python vagy Java alkalmazásokat fordított proxy és Systemd segítségével integrálom, hogy a naplók, az SSL és a biztonsági mentések központosítva maradjanak. A Pro funkció többfelhasználós kezeléssel az ügynökségeknek érdemes, mert a szerepek és az ügyfelek tisztán elkülönítve maradnak. A termelési környezeteket helyi teszt VM-eken tükrözöm, és a konfigurációkat exportálom az ismételhető beállítások érdekében. Bárki, aki alternatívákat vizsgál, olyan összehasonlításokat von le, mint pl. KeyHelp az aaPanel ellen a csapatfolyamatok megfelelő összehangolása.

Költségmodell: Mi marad ingyenes?

Az alapfunkciókat használom az aaPanel segítségével ingyenesen, akár magán-, akár üzleti céllal. Ezek közé tartozik a weboldal- és adatbázis-kezelés, SSL, cron, biztonsági mentés, naplóelemzés, tűzfal, WAF és a WP Toolkit. Néhány vállalati jellegű bővítmény, mint például a több fiókos felhasználók vagy a kiterjesztett felügyelet, pénzbe kerül, de általában jóval a normál panel licencek havi euróban kifejezett ára alatt van. Az ingyenes csomag sok beállításhoz elegendő, különösen egyetlen szerver vagy kisebb ügyfélhalmazok esetében. Ahogy a projekt növekszik, prémium modulokat veszek fel, és szemmel tartom a teljes költséget példányonként.

Gyakorlati tippek a nagy teljesítményhez

A webkiszolgáló motort a projekt céljának megfelelően választom ki, és gyakran támaszkodom a Nginx vagy OpenLiteSpeed a gyors szállításhoz. A PHP-FPM-et poolok, Opcache és megfelelő memóriakorlátok segítségével optimalizálom, hogy a csúcsterhelések zökkenőmentesen működjenek. Az adatbázisokat lekérdezéselemzéssel, indexekkel és különálló adatmennyiségekkel tartom gyorsan. A WordPress esetében kombinálom az objektum gyorsítótárat (Redis), az oldal gyorsítótárat és a képtömörítést a TTFB és LCP értékek csökkentése érdekében. CDN, HTTP/2 vagy HTTP/3 és tiszta CORS fejlécek ésszerűen egészítik ki a betöltési időket és a biztonságot.

Más panelekről való áttérés megkönnyítve

Átviszem a projekteket a Plesk vagy cPanel lépésről lépésre: készítse elő a tartományt és a DNS-t, exportálja a webrootot és az adatbázist, majd importálja a célrendszeren. Az SSL-tanúsítványokat közvetlenül a panelben újítom meg a Let's Encrypt-en keresztül, hogy elkerüljem a lejárt tanúsítványok okozta hibákat. Az IMAP szinkronizációs eszközökkel áttelepítem az e-mail postafiókokat, majd tesztelem a küldési és fogadási útvonalakat. Az állásidő-mentes migráció érdekében rövid TTL-ablakot választok, és csak a végső adatszinkronizálás után váltok DNS-t. Így még az üzletek vagy a nagy forgalmú magazinok is biztonságosan költözhetnek.

Megfelelő felhasználási forgatókönyvek

Az aaPanelt használom Ügynökségek sok WordPress példányban, klubhonlapok és MVP-k számára alacsony költségű VPS-en. Az oktatási intézmények számára előnyös, mert a tanulók gyorsan elindíthatják és kezelhetik a produktív stackeket. Az induló vállalkozások rugalmas panelt kapnak, amely lehetővé teszi a skálázást több szerveren és felhőszolgáltatáson keresztül. A kkv-k adminjai a szétszórt szkripteket és eszközöket egyetlen felületen konszolidálják. Az aaPanel még laboratóriumi környezetekhez is alkalmas, mert új szolgáltatásokat tesztelhetek, és nyomok hátrahagyása nélkül újra eltávolíthatom őket.

Rendszerkövetelmények és bevált beállítások

Az erőforrásokat pragmatikusan méretezem: 1-2 vCPU, 2-4 GB RAM és 30-60 GB SSD elegendő a kis WordPress oldalakhoz. Több projekt vagy WooCommerce esetén 4-8 GB RAM-ot, dedikált PHP-poolokat és külön adatmennyiségeket számolok. A swapot mérsékelten tartom (pl. 1-2 GB), hogy a csúcsokat tompítsam az I/O túlterhelése nélkül. OS-nek inkább LTS disztribúciókat használok, mert a kernel és a csomagok karbantartása hosszú távon tervezhető. Külön lemezt vagy gyors tárolási tier-t érdemes legkésőbb az adatbázisoknál használni, hogy az IOPS és a késleltetés ne lassítsa a dolgokat.

Hálózati és port-ellenőrzési lista

Az indulás előtt ellenőrzöm a legfontosabb szolgáltatások kiadásait: 22/SSH, 80/HTTP, 443/HTTPS, a panel (alapértelmezés szerint magas TCP port, pl. 8888), adatbázisok (3306 MySQL/MariaDB, 5432 PostgreSQL - ha külsőleg szükséges), Redis (6379, főleg belső), valamint a levelezési portok (25/465/587 SMTP, 110/995 POP3, 143/993 IMAP). A nyílt szolgáltatásokat mindig tűzfalszabályokkal korlátozom, az adatbázis-portokat csak megbízható hálózatok számára nyitom meg, és TCP wrappereket/Fail2ban-t használok a további biztonság érdekében. A Let's Encrypt esetében ellenőrzöm, hogy a 80/443 elérhető-e, és hogy az upstream proxyk nem hamisítják-e meg a kéréseket.

E-mail működés: kézbesíthetőség és alternatívák

A levelezőszerverek gyakran a legtrükkösebb rész. Megfelelően állítom be az SPF, DKIM és DMARC protokollt, meggyőződöm arról, hogy érvényes rDNS (PTR) van-e, és ellenőrzöm, hogy nincsenek-e feketelisták. Ha hiányzik a tiszta hírnév, vagy a 25-ös portot blokkolja a szolgáltató, akkor a kimenő leveleket egy relé szolgáltatáson keresztül irányítom. Külön sorokat tervezek a csúcsterhelésre, és figyelemmel kísérem az elhalasztási/visszapattanási arányokat. A postafiókokat IMAP szinkronizálással migrálom, és a költözés után rendbe teszem a kvótákat/mappastruktúrát. Azoknak a csapatoknak, amelyek nem akarnak saját maguknak e-mailezni, tudatosan elkülönítem a levelezést, és a panelt elsősorban webes és adatbázisok kezelésére használom.

Automatizálás és megismételhető telepítések

A beállításokat szkripteken keresztül szabványosítom, és a panel funkcióit GUI-n vagy API-n keresztül használom a domainek, SSL és adatbázisok következetes létrehozásához. Az ismétlődő feladatokat (biztonsági mentések, cron, naplóforgatás, tanúsítvány megújítás) sablonként határozom meg. Leírom a csapatok számára az „arany veremet“: Webszerver, PHP-verziók, modulok, biztonsági alapvonal, felhasználói szerepkörök és mentési célpontok. Ez lehetővé teszi egy új szerver reprodukálhatóan, kevesebb mint egy óra alatt történő beállítását. Az IaC eszközei segítenek az alapcsomagok, a systemd egységek és a kernel paramétereinek előzetes konfigurálásában, míg a panel a webspecifikus feladatokról gondoskodik.

Monitoring és megfigyelhetőség

Az integrált statisztikákat külső üzemidő- és teljesítményfigyeléssel kombinálom. A VPS CPU lopása, az IOwait a tárolókra, a RAM/swap trendek, az 5xx kvóták a webszervereken és a TLS hibák kritikusak. A figyelmeztető küszöbértékeket konzervatívan állítom be, és a figyelmeztetéseket Slackre/emailre továbbítom. Az adatbázisok esetében naplózom a lassú lekérdezéseket, és készenlétben tartom a lekérdezési terveket az indexek testreszabásához. A biztonsági mentéseket visszaállítási mintákon keresztül ellenőrzöm - ideális esetben automatizáltan egy előkészítő VM-en. Rendszeres teszt-visszaállítások nélkül minden mentés csak feltételezés marad.

Szerepek, jogok és megfelelés

Ügyfelenként/projektenként külön számlákkal dolgozom. Minimális írási jogosultságokat adok („legkisebb jogosultság“), és elkülönítem a telepítő felhasználókat az admin fiókoktól. A panelbejelentkezéseket 2FA-val és IP-korlátozással biztosítom. A GDPR/megfelelőség érdekében titkosítom a biztonsági mentéseket mozgásban és nyugalomban, naplózom a rendszergazdai hozzáférést, és egyértelmű megőrzési időszakokat határozok meg. Az érzékeny naplóadatokat szükség esetén rotálom és anonimizálom. Az átadásokhoz a jelszavakat, tokeneket és tanúsítványokat egy titokkezelő rendszerben dokumentálom, nem pedig a fájlkezelőben.

Korlátok és ismert buktatók

Az aaPanel sok mindent lefed, de nem csodaszer. A többszerveres topológiákhoz, a fürtös adatbázisokhoz vagy a nulla leállási idejű bevezetésekhez további eszközökre van szükség. A masszív, több bérlővel rendelkező környezetek esetében nagyon tudatosan tervezem az izolációt (konténerek/VM-ek) és a kvótákat. Gyakori buktatók a PHP-verziók inkonzisztens volta a staging/prod között, a migrációk utáni helytelen fájljogosultságok, a túl nagyvonalú tűzfalengedélyek vagy az elfelejtett cronjobok. Ezért készen áll egy rövid go-live-ellenőrzési lista, és automatizálom a legfontosabb ellenőrzéseket.

Hibaelhárítási játékkönyv

  • A Let's Encrypt nem működik: Ellenőrizze a DNS-A rekordot, a 80/443-as portot, a webroot és a proxy fejlécet; figyelje a sebességkorlátokat.
  • 502/504 hibák: Ellenőrizze a PHP FPM poolokat, a maximális gyermekeket/kéréseket, az időkorlátokat és az upstream naplókat; azonosítsa a lassú bővítményeket.
  • Magas CPU/IO: Csökkentse a botforgalmat WAF/aránykorlátozással, aktiválja a gyorsítótárazást, elemezze a lekérdezési naplót, kövesse nyomon a kép- és eszközoptimalizálást.
  • A levél a spamben végzi: SPF/DKIM/DMARC tesztelés, rDNS beállítása, feladói domain „bemelegítése“, relay megfontolása.
  • Engedélyezési problémák: 403/500 elkerülése érdekében javítsa ki a webroot és a feltöltési könyvtárak tulajdonosait/csoportjait.

Frissítési és karbantartási stratégia

A frissítéseket szakaszosan végzem: A frissítéseket karbantartási ablakokban végzem: először a staging, majd a produktív szerver. Minden nagyobb ugrás előtt biztonsági mentést készítek a panelről és a rendszerkonfigurációról, pillanatfelvételt készítek (VPS/felhő esetén), és készen áll egy visszaállítási szkript. Frissítések után tesztelem a kritikus útvonalakat: TLS handshake, PHP-verziók, átírási szabályok, cron munkák, mentési munkák, levéláramlás. A kisebb frissítéseket azonnal telepítem, a nagyobb frissítéseket megfontoltan tervezem, és dokumentálom a törő változásokat. Ezáltal a szerverek naprakészen maradnak anélkül, hogy a termelési rendszerek veszélybe kerülnének.

Skálázás és magas rendelkezésre állás

Ha a forgalom nő, horizontálisan skálázom: egy terheléskiegyenlítő elöl, több webes csomópont hátul, megosztott objektum gyorsítótár (Redis) és egy dedikált adatbázis-állomás. A médiatartalmakat objektumtárolóba szervezem ki, hogy a telepítés és a biztonsági mentés karcsú maradjon. Az adatbázisok esetében szükség szerint replikációra vagy klaszterhálózatra támaszkodom, és külön olvasási/írási hozzáférést biztosítok. A munkameneteket központosítva tartom (Redis), vagy csak token-alapú hitelesítést használok, hogy a csomópontok változása átlátható maradjon. Az aaPanel helyileg kezeli az egyes szervereket; külső eszközöket és egyértelmű playbookokat használok a több hoszton keresztüli orchestráláshoz.

Szűk körű értékelés

Az aaPanelben látok egy erős lehetőség, ha saját maga szeretné kezelni a szervereket, és meg akarja spórolni a licencköltségeket. Az egykattintásos stackek, a tiszta WordPress-integráció, a biztonsági modulok és a biztonsági mentési stratégiák keveréke megbízhatóan lefedi a modern webes projekteket. Ha csapatokat, ügyfeleket és SLA követelményeket kell kiszolgálnia, akkor hozzáadhat speciális Pro funkciókat, vagy kombinálhatja az aaPanelt professzionális tárhelyszolgáltatással. Mindent egybevetve a panel áttekinthető, gyors munkakörnyezetet biztosít, amely kézen fogja a kezdőket, és nem lassítja a profikat. Ezzel egy olyan ingyenes vezérlőpanelt kap Ázsiából, amely a gyakorlatban lenyűgöző, és hosszú távon együtt fog nőni Önnel.

Aktuális cikkek